If you trim tall grass and weeds at ground level, the stems are liable to tangle around the trimmer head and stall it. Roger's solution is to trim tall weeds from the top down, so the string chomps them into little pieces. For big fields of grass, consider getting a special grass-cutting head that has three plastic blades designed to lay the stems down flat without tangling the mechanism.
